Lake Village, a popular destination within Yellowstone National Park, is located in Park County, Wyoming. This area, situated on the northwest shore of Yellowstone Lake, offers visitors a range of amenities and activities. Corwin Springs, a small unincorporated community in Montana, is situated remarkably close to Yellowstone National Park.
